How to diagnose nasopharyngeal carcinoma

How to diagnose nasopharyngeal carcinoma

Nasopharyngeal carcinoma is a common malignant tumor of the head and face. The early symptoms are not obvious. The diagnosis of nasopharyngeal carcinoma cannot be determined solely by its own symptoms. Laboratory and imaging examinations are the main basis for diagnosing nasopharyngeal carcinoma. The following is a brief introduction on how to diagnose nasopharyngeal carcinoma.

1. Anterior rhinoscopy: After the nasal mucosa is retracted, the posterior nasal cavity and nasopharynx can be viewed through the anterior rhinoscopy to detect cancer that has invaded or is adjacent to the nostril.

2. Indirect nasopharyngeal endoscopy: This method is simple and practical. Each wall of the nasopharynx should be examined in turn. Pay attention to the posterior wall of the nasopharyngeal roof and the pharyngeal recesses on both sides. The corresponding parts on both sides should be observed. Any asymmetrical submucosal protrusions or isolated nodules on both sides should be paid more attention. 3. Fiberoptic nasopharyngeal endoscopy: This method is simple and the mirror is well fixed, but the observation of the posterior nasal cavity and the anterior wall of the roof is not satisfactory.

4. Neck biopsy: For cases where nasopharyngeal biopsy has failed to confirm the diagnosis, a neck mass biopsy can be performed.

5. Fine needle aspiration is a simple, safe and efficient method for tumor diagnosis. It has been highly recommended in recent years. For patients suspected of cervical lymph node metastasis, fine needle aspiration can be used to obtain cells first. After removal, the aspirate can be subjected to cytological or pathological examination.

6. EB virus serological test: If the diagnosis is still not confirmed, regular follow-up should be performed, and multiple biopsy examinations should be performed if necessary.

7. Nasopharyngeal lateral film, skull base film and CT examination. Every patient should be routinely examined with nasopharyngeal lateral film and skull base film. If there is suspected invasion of the paranasal sinus, middle ear or other parts, corresponding radiographs should be taken at the same time. Units with conditions should perform CT scans to understand the local extension, especially the infiltration range of the parapharyngeal space, which is extremely important for determining the clinical stage and formulating treatment plans.

8. Type B ultrasound examination: Type B ultrasound examination has been widely used in the diagnosis and treatment of nasopharyngeal carcinoma. The method is simple, non-destructive, and is a commonly used method for nasopharyngeal carcinoma diagnosis.

9. Magnetic resonance imaging can diagnose nasopharyngeal carcinoma, frontal sinus cancer, etc., and show the relationship between the tumor and surrounding tissues.
